text: E. M. Rose is a historian of medieval and early modern England and a journalist, and the inaugural visiting scholar in the Program in Medieval Studies at Harvard University, best known for the book The Murder of William of Norwich. Rose worked as a producer at CNN for a decade prior to beginning a career as a historian. She has taught at Princeton University, Johns Hopkins, Villanova, and Baruch College.
